Icebreaker Toolkit: Easy, Adaptable Openers
Feeling stuck on what to say is normal. Use these simple, low-pressure patterns to start conversations that feel natural and invite a reply.
Profile-based hooks
- Observation + question: Pick one small detail from their profile and ask about it. Example: “You mentioned weekend hikes — what trail made you fall in love with hiking?”
- Curiosity with a choice: Turn a fact into a quick choice to make replying easy. Example: “Coffee shop or picnic for a first casual hangout?”
- Genuine compliment tied to context: Avoid vague praise. Example: “Your travel photo looks epic — was that a planned trip or a spontaneous detour?”
Reliable opener patterns
- Two-part question: Short, specific first question + follow-up that invites detail. Example: “Do you prefer city mornings or beach mornings? Any favorite local spot?”
- Playful fact check: Lightly challenge something in their profile. Example: “You claim to be a salsa pro — true or practicing?”
- Mini game: Use a quick, fun choice to spark back-and-forth. Example: “Pancakes or waffles? Tell me which and why in one sentence.”
How to avoid bland, creepy, or copy-paste messages
- Skip generic lines: “Hey” or “You’re hot” rarely lead to conversations. Replace them with one specific detail or question.
- Don’t over-flatter early: Keep compliments concrete and brief rather than intense or romantic right away.
- Steer clear of heavy topics: Avoid deep relationship or personal trauma questions in the first messages; aim for light, two-way exchange.
Light callbacks and follow-ups
- Reference their last reply: If they mention a hobby, follow up with a related, easy question. Example: “You said you play guitar — what song do you always play at a gathering?”
- Offer a small personal detail: Reply with your own short answer to keep balance. Example: “Pancakes — maple syrup all the way. What’s your go-to topping?”
- Use timing to keep it natural: If they respond slowly, match the pace but stay friendly; a simple follow-up after a day or two is fine.
Quick checklist before you hit send
- Is the opener tied to their profile or interests?
- Does it invite a short, specific answer?
- Is the tone light and respectful?
- Could someone use this as a template without feeling copy-pasted?
Keep it short, be curious, and make replies easy. Small, thoughtful starters on Mingle2 lead to better conversations more often than perfect lines.
